Washington
,
DC
–
Citing
his record of service to Marylanders and the American people, the
Republican Main Street Partnership PAC is endorsing Rep. Wayne
Gilchrest for reelection to the House of Representatives in 2004.
“Gilchrest
has been an outstanding representative in Congress,” said RMSP
PAC spokeswoman Kerry Kantin said. “His passion for the environment coupled with his pragmatic
fiscal conservatism continues to prove he is a perfect fit for
Maryland
’s first district.”
Recently
another Republican announced he would challenge Gilchrest in the
GOP primary. Gilchrest, an RMSP
member, has successfully defeated primary challengers in previous
elections (in 2002 he defeated his GOP opponent 60 to 36 percent).
Main Street
has backed Gilchrest’s previous re-election bids.
